Transaction 57f25358553296803239a70cadc900d32b3dccc4548c05998473f4a027e53e20
1 Input
2 Outputs
- 57f25358553296803239a70cadc900d32b3dccc4548c05998473f4a027e53e20:0
- 57f25358553296803239a70cadc900d32b3dccc4548c05998473f4a027e53e20:1
value 12880
address 1Ddx7Pn7ndXuQAYyEN8t2wDvCFsyuPAkaA
value 10000000
address 19kFAc9uv176tGwWp8hcWtD5SkQkeCQj6B